The Trump administration is broadening the Mexico City Policy to prohibit U.S. funding not only for organizations that perform or promote abortions but also for those advocating diversity, equity, and inclusion (DEI) initiatives. This announcement was made by Vice President J.D. Vance during the March for Life event in Washington, D.C. The expanded policy will impact over $30 billion in foreign aid, affecting both foreign and U.S.-based NGOs. This move aims to address concerns from conservative activists regarding abortion access and DEI policies, amidst ongoing debates about the availability of abortion medications. Vance emphasized the administration's commitment to protecting life and countering what they describe as radical gender ideologies.

Key Details: • The expanded policy targets both international and U.S. NGOs. • It encompasses over $30 billion in foreign assistance, significantly increasing its scope. • The announcement aligns with ongoing conservative pressure to limit access to abortion medications.
